Denmark's CIP Launches $3B Offshore Wind Project in the Philippines

Copenhagen Infrastructure Partners (CIP) will invest $3 billion in its first Southeast Asian offshore wind project in the Philippines, in partnership with ACEN.

The project, located in Camarines Sur, aims to expand renewable capacity and reduce reliance on imported fossil fuels, reflecting the Philippines' renewable energy ambitions.

The investment reflects strong confidence in the Philippines' renewable energy ambitions and improving investment climate.

According to Palace Press Officer Claire Castro, the venture demonstrates sustained interest from foreign companies in the Philippines' renewable energy sector.
